
在Excel中提取年份的后两位,可以使用函数、文本操作、日期函数等多种方法,如TEXT函数、RIGHT函数、YEAR函数,具体操作步骤如下:RIGHT函数、TEXT函数、结合其他函数。 其中,使用RIGHT函数是最常用的方式,可以通过简单的公式将年份的后两位提取出来。
例如,假设在A列中有一个日期"2023-10-01",我们可以在B列使用公式 =RIGHT(YEAR(A1),2) 提取年份的后两位,即 "23"。该方法简单易用,且适用于大多数日期格式。
一、RIGHT函数
1、基本操作
RIGHT函数是Excel中一个常用的文本函数,用于从文本字符串的右边提取指定数量的字符。若我们的日期在A1单元格,公式为=RIGHT(YEAR(A1),2)。YEAR函数先提取年份,而RIGHT函数则从年份的右边提取两个字符。
2、实际案例
假设在A列有一系列日期,如下:
- A1: 2023-01-01
- A2: 2022-05-15
- A3: 2021-12-31
我们可以在B列输入公式 =RIGHT(YEAR(A1),2),然后向下拖动填充公式。结果将显示为:
- B1: 23
- B2: 22
- B3: 21
这种方法非常直观且易于理解,但需要注意的是,YEAR函数提取的是日期格式的年份部分,所以输入的日期格式应为Excel可识别的日期格式。
二、TEXT函数
1、基本操作
TEXT函数可以将数值格式化为指定的文本格式。在提取年份的后两位时,我们可以将日期格式化为"YY"格式。假设日期在A1单元格,公式为=TEXT(A1,"YY")。
2、实际案例
假设在A列有一系列日期,如下:
- A1: 2023-01-01
- A2: 2022-05-15
- A3: 2021-12-31
我们可以在B列输入公式 =TEXT(A1,"YY"),然后向下拖动填充公式。结果将显示为:
- B1: 23
- B2: 22
- B3: 21
与RIGHT函数不同,TEXT函数可以直接将日期格式化为指定的文本格式,避免了YEAR函数的中间步骤。
三、结合其他函数
1、DATE函数和TEXT函数结合
有时我们需要结合多个函数来实现更复杂的操作。假设我们有一个日期在A1单元格,我们可以使用DATE函数和TEXT函数结合提取年份的后两位。公式为=TEXT(DATE(YEAR(A1),1,1),"YY")。
2、实际案例
假设在A列有一系列日期,如下:
- A1: 2023-01-01
- A2: 2022-05-15
- A3: 2021-12-31
我们可以在B列输入公式 =TEXT(DATE(YEAR(A1),1,1),"YY"),然后向下拖动填充公式。结果将显示为:
- B1: 23
- B2: 22
- B3: 21
这种方法结合了DATE函数和TEXT函数的优势,更加灵活,适用于复杂的日期计算需求。
四、使用Excel VBA提取年份后两位
1、VBA简介
Excel VBA(Visual Basic for Applications)是Excel的编程语言,可以实现更复杂的操作。我们可以编写VBA代码来提取年份的后两位。
2、编写VBA代码
我们可以在Excel中按Alt+F11打开VBA编辑器,插入一个新模块,并粘贴以下代码:
Function ExtractYearLastTwoDigits(dateCell As Range) As String
Dim yearStr As String
yearStr = Year(dateCell.Value)
ExtractYearLastTwoDigits = Right(yearStr, 2)
End Function
保存并关闭VBA编辑器。在Excel工作表中,假设日期在A1单元格,我们可以在B1单元格输入公式 =ExtractYearLastTwoDigits(A1),然后向下拖动填充公式。结果将显示为:
- B1: 23
- B2: 22
- B3: 21
通过VBA代码,我们可以更加灵活地处理复杂的日期和文本操作。
五、应用场景和注意事项
1、不同日期格式的处理
在实际工作中,日期格式可能有所不同,如“2023/10/01”、“2023.10.01”等。需要确保日期格式一致,以便函数能够正确识别和处理。
2、批量操作
对于大批量数据,可以使用Excel的自动填充功能快速应用公式。同时,建议在操作前备份数据,避免误操作导致数据丢失。
3、结合其他数据处理
提取年份的后两位只是数据处理的一部分,实际应用中可能需要结合其他数据处理操作,如筛选、排序、汇总等。可以根据具体需求选择合适的函数和方法,提高工作效率。
4、应用场景
提取年份后两位在许多实际应用中都很有用,如分析数据的时间趋势、制作年度报告、生成年份标识等。通过掌握不同的方法,可以灵活应对各种场景,提高数据处理的精准度和效率。
六、总结
在Excel中提取年份的后两位有多种方法,包括RIGHT函数、TEXT函数、结合其他函数、使用VBA等。每种方法都有其优点和适用场景,可以根据实际需求选择合适的方法。通过掌握这些技巧,可以更高效地处理日期数据,提高工作效率。
相关问答FAQs:
Q: 如何在Excel中提取日期的年份后两位?
Q: 我如何从Excel的日期中提取年份的后两位数字?
Q: 在Excel中,如何截取日期的年份并仅保留后两位数字?
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4846933